Frequently Downpoured Questions

What is the importance of Commercial Building Gutters?

Gutters play a vital role in protecting commercial buildings from water damage and soil erosion. They're not just for aesthetics; they're a crucial aspect of building upkeep.

What materials are used in Commercial Gutter Installation?

Commercial gutters often use galvanized steel or aluminum due to their long lifespan and affordability.

Why are Commercial Gutters larger than Residential Gutters?

Commercial gutters cater to the larger roof areas typical of commercial buildings – thus their larger size to effectively handle the increased water flow.
